To program and play only the discs

you want to hear (CUSTOM play)

This unit lets you program up to 100 of your favorite discs. For

example, you can store all the discs of your favorite artist, or some
other group of personal selections, and play only those discs.

You can even add other discs to the custom later on.

NoteH

You cannot change the discs stored in the CUSTOM file. Likewise,

you cannot erase just one disc from the CUSTOM file.

• Pressing

DISC

(-/+) during CUSTOM playback lets you choose

among other discs stored in the CUSTOM file.

• If you use the

digit

buttons and

DISC SET

on the remote control

during CUSTOM playback to choose a disc not stored in the
CUSTOM file, " * *

NO DISC"

will be displayed for approximately

3 seconds.

• When a disc appointed to the CUSTOM file is not loaded in the

rack, " * *

NO DISC"

is displayed for approximately 3 seconds,

the disc is erased from memory, and CUSTOM searches for the
next disc.

• The discs stored in the CUSTOM file will not be erased when you

turn off the power.

• Items stored in memory are saved, even if the power cord is

unplugged.

(Memory Back-Up Function).

• While the hood is open,

DISC

{-/+) cannot be used for CUSTOM

file entry.
